Originally Posted by Black and White
Man that gap between Durant and Bron isn't that big..... damn ESPN
This year for MVP voting? Its 29 to 20. The gap should be even bigger. What exactly is the argument for Lebron over Durant? Durant has better stats, less help, and has led his team to a better record playing in a harder conference. Now, that doesn't mean I'm saying Durant is a better player then Lebron. I'd say that could only be determined at the end of the year and Lebron's been coasting IMO. But based on how they usually vote for the MVP, Durant is clearly above everyone.

Originally Posted by knicksman
lebron shouldnt have won the last 2 mvps coz of kobe/shaq rule but what do you expect from espn? their analysts are just your average person
What Kobe/Shaq rule? They didn't win more MVPs playing together mainly because they either missed too many games and/or Tim Duncan. Only legit gripe is AI winning over Shaq in 2001, and the criticism may should be AI winning over Duncan that year.
Either way, Wade in the last 2 years has not been close to Shaq or Kobe from 2001-2004.
